I'm going to play devils advocate here for a moment...

Doesn't it kinda' make sense that the best performers rise to the top, and the music consumer wants them to perform the best songs? I think the problem is a composition is physical, it's tactile and easy to own, but a performance isn't. However, without the right performance the composition goes nowhere. If the performance is what's selling the composition, then isn't it only fair that the performer own a piece of that?

Just as there are a thousand lyricists for every musician, aren't there a thousand musicians for every great performer?
